50 Years Old Icelandic Coast Guard Vessel On Sale

November 6, 2020 GDC 0

It has been announced over the weekend that the Coast Guard Patrol ship Ægir will be sold after 50 years of service, mbl reports. The Ægir-class offshore patrol vessel is a class of two offshore patrol vessels serving in the Icelandic Coast […]
